View Single Post
Posts: 1,269 | Thanked: 3,961 times | Joined on May 2011 @ Brazil
#54
Originally Posted by qole View Post
I am linking to the tarball of my scripts. It is the beginnings of a .deb package, but I haven't figured out what I need to add to a .deb in Open Mode yet, and I wanted to get these scripts out there for you all to start using.

Basically just copy the files in the src/ directory into your phone's file system. I have made a "fake sudo" which is just an alias for "ssh root@localhost", but for it to work properly in scripts (i.e. no passwords), you should set up ssh key authentication.
Good news, I have success on running Easy Debian using Inception+opensh+"aegisctl -s" on my Nokia N9. Including LXDE, OpenOffice, etc. I will try to write a how-to-do-it (after recovering my N9, read below).

Bad news : it is not a good idea to replace "/etc/init/ssh.conf" because it is included in Aegis, see here more details. So I suggest to remove the "/src/etc/" folder of "HarmChom" (and explain what to edit in "sshd_config" or even "ssh.conf").

After copying the full content of "HarmChom/src/" and rebooting, ssh refused to accept connections on port 22. My attempts to fix this problem (removing openssh-server, etc) yielded a (almost) "bricked" N9. I am trying to recover it.

PS: I've recovered my N9 by flashing the firmware (so all software installed were lost). Ok, it is good because I will soon try to install Harmattan Open Mode (so Inception will be removed).
__________________
Python, C/C++, Qt and CAS developer. For Maemo/MeeGo/Sailfish :
Integral, Derivative, Limit - calculating mathematical integrals, derivatives and limits. SymPy - Computer Algebra System.
MatPlotLib - 2D & 3D plots in Python. IPython - Python interactive shell.
-- My blog about mobile & scientific computing ---
Sailfish : Sony Xperia X, Gemini, Jolla, Jolla C, Jolla Tablet, Nexus 4. Nokia N9, N900, N810.

Last edited by rcolistete; 2012-03-18 at 08:18. Reason: N9 recovered
 

The Following 2 Users Say Thank You to rcolistete For This Useful Post: